Despite in mourning, Ananth Kumar's wife plants sapling, supports green initiative

Bengaluru: It has been six days since former Union minister Ananth Kumar passed away. His wife Tejaswini Ananth Kumar, who runs the Adamya Chethana non-government organisation (NGO) came out to plant saplings on the occasion of ‘Green Sunday’.Adamya Chethana has been observing Green Sunday since 151 weeks. Ananth Kumar too was fond of greenery and environment issues. Continuing his concern, Tejaswini also watered the sapling. Ananth Kumar's brother Nandakumar was also seen on the occasion.The park was named Ananthvana in 2015 and tributes were paid to Ananth Kumar before starting the event.
